What We Actually Do During a Boiler Service

We get it—you want to know what you’re paying for. Here’s what’s included in your boiler service:

  • Visual inspection – we check for signs of leaks, corrosion, or anything that looks a bit “off”.
  • Internal check – we remove the boiler casing and take a close look at key components like the burner, heat exchanger, and seals.
  • Cleaning – we clean any parts that need a little TLC to keep everything ticking along.
  • System testing – we test flue emissions, gas pressure, safety devices, and controls to make sure your boiler is running efficiently and safely.
  • Paperwork – we fill out your logbook, let you know how everything looks, and offer any advice if we spot something worth keeping an eye on.

Got an Older Boiler? Here’s What to Know

Older boilers have served you well—but just like a favourite old car, sometimes a service can highlight parts that are on their last legs.

After a service, there’s a small chance that:

  • worn-out part might pack in once it’s been cleaned or tested. (Sometimes things that were just hanging on call it quits.)
  • Replacement parts may not be readily available for very old models. We’ll always do our best to track things down or suggest suitable alternatives.

We’ll always keep you in the loop. No pressure, no pushy sales—just honest advice and clear options if anything needs attention.
